Laundry pods vs liquid

Choosing between laundry pods vs liquid detergent depends largely on your priorities, use cases, risk factors, and environmental views. Rather than viewing one as universally “better,” identify the product format that best aligns with your needs and values. Those wanting ultimate convenience and portability may benefit most from pods.

As for price: powdered is always cheaper, all else being equal. Liquid detergent contains water, which costs a lot to ship, and therefore costs more. Detergent Pods: Detergent pods, also known as laundry pods or pacs, have gained immense popularity for their convenience and precise dosing. These are pre-measured, water-soluble packets containing concentrated liquid detergent. Learn about benefits, ingredients, … Laundry Pods. The first laundry detergent pods were launched in 2012 and have become increasingly popular over the last 10 years. Laundry pods contain concentrated liquid detergent in a water-soluble pouch. The pouch dissolves in the washing machine, releasing the cleaning ingredients to wash your garments effectively. The answer is that depending on the detergent, the primary ingredient may or may not be water. The primary ingredient for the liquid laundry detergent in the big bottles is water. Because water is the primary ingredient, the liquid laundry detergent will freeze at around 32F, which is the freezing point of water. Laundry Pods.
